Transaction 98baae880cb9cd7992739af0331db30cc778a5d9528ffd640b94adf723c44210
1 Input
2 Outputs
- 98baae880cb9cd7992739af0331db30cc778a5d9528ffd640b94adf723c44210:0
- 98baae880cb9cd7992739af0331db30cc778a5d9528ffd640b94adf723c44210:1
value 965080595
address 18hcXhJkYW29BFZUmVN76vRoPxu13VdSed
value 10805692
address 1HsVfrb6yTx81hrqjR1cxdbq7fDRe55Gtm